In something less than earth-shattering news, Diamondbacks manager Torey Lovullo on Wednesday named right-hander Zack Greinke his Opening Day starter, an announcement that was more procedural than anything.
Though Greinke is coming off a down year, he’s still the club’s most accomplished starter -- not to mention it’s highest paid – so it’s no surprise he’s again getting the nod.
Lovullo also said Greinke will make his first start of the Cactus League on Friday, an outing that puts him about an outing behind the rest of his teammates.
“He’s probably five days different than everybody else, which was part of the thought process from the very beginning,” Lovullo said.
